Setting up and applying a suitable Page Setup for your drawings
- [Instructor] We're starting another chapter now where we're going to take a look at plotting and publishing, our little mechanical plate that we've designed in 3D and AutoCAD. Now it is a very simple design and I've done that deliberately so that it doesn't take away from learning the workflows and methodologies that you need to use when your 3D modeling in mechanical design in AutoCAD. Now when you open up the new drawing which is Metal Plate_PUBLISHING.dwg, you'll see the metal plate there in the top view in the model tab. So download the drawing from the library, Metal Plate_PUBLISHING.dwg, and when you open it up, it should look like what you've got on the screen. Now we're in the top view in the model tab and we're using... At the moment, you can see the conceptual visual style which is absolutely fine for our purposes right now.
